About These Bases

Base 60

In base 60, each digit position represents a power of 60: the rightmost digit counts individual ones, the next counts groups of 60, the next counts groups of 60×60, and so on — the same place-value idea as base 10, just with 60 distinct digits instead of ten.

Base 40

Base 40 works the same way: the rightmost digit counts ones, the next counts groups of 40, the next counts groups of 40×40, and so on, using 40 distinct digits.
